Best Schools in Razor, TX
Razor, TX has a total of 8 schools including 3 high schools, 3 middle schools and 2 elementary schools. A total of 2,374 students attend Razor, TX schools. On average, schools in Razor score 31%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 32%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Razor meet exp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Razor, TX
City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
Razor, TX has a total population of 143 with 16%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 84%, and 11%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
